Excellent program! My son (9 yo) had his first experience with this program at the Bill Sadowski Park in Palmetto Bay for his spring break. He did the fishing camp.
The camp was awesome. It was very affordable considering the quality, activities, and comparative value to other programs around me.
Willy, Peter, Eric and the rest of the crew went above and beyond to make me as a parent feel very safe and comfortable with my son there, and surely made my son feel welcomed.
The long hours are great if needed for working parents, too.
My son came home daily with an information card about his day and what they did, and they even went on a field trip to THE KEYS!
They got to do a private tour at the dolphin research facility down there on the last day of camp. Camp was already awesome, but this extra feature made the $185 for the week TOTALLY WORTH IT. The camp week fee included transportation and entry for the keys trip AND all the other activities during the week.
They did archery, fishing, animal education/encounter, hiking, and more.
We already signed up for summer.
